In the fascinating world of 17th-century Dutch art, "The Oyster Feast" by Hendrick van der Burgh stands out for its elegance and narrative richness. This artwork, which immerses us in a scene of conviviality around a maritime feast, evokes both the pleasure of gastronomy and the joys of good company. The vibrant colors and meticulous details of this scene demonstrate exceptional technical mastery, inviting the viewer to delve into the intimacy of this shared moment. The oysters, symbols of refinement and luxury, are highlighted, prompting reflection on the fleeting pleasures of life. Style and uniqueness of the work Hendrick van der Burgh, through "The Oyster Feast," offers a carefully orchestrated composition, where each element seems deliberately placed. The light plays a fundamental role, illuminating the faces of the guests while emphasizing the textures of the food. This play of light and shadow gives the scene striking depth, creating an atmosphere that is both warm and intimate. The details of the characters' clothing, as well as the delicate tableware, reveal a meticulous attention to detail characteristic of the art of that period. The painting invites prolonged contemplation, each glance revealing a new nuance, a new reflection. This stylistic singularity, blending realism and sensitivity, makes the work a true masterpiece of still life, transcending the simple register of a feast to become a celebration of life.
